Environments for Fareloom, our shipping-fee rules engine. There are three: sandbox (anything goes, reset nightly), staging (mirrors prod rules with fake carrier rates), and prod. Release manager note: rule bundles promote sandbox → staging → prod, never skipping a step, and staging soak is 24 hours minimum. Each environment's evaluator picks up the settings shown directly below.

config for kafof-bawef:
holath:
  log_level: debug
  metrics_host: metrics.holath.qorvelsys.internal
  pin: 2191
  pool_size: 32

Visitor Policy — Landlord Site Audit. On Thursday next week, representatives of Pellwright Estates will conduct their annual audit of Brindlemoor Court. Visiting contractors should expect brief access checks at all entrances and must keep visitor lanyards visible at all times. Work in plant rooms may be paused for up to twenty minutes during the walkthrough. Contractors needing the east service corridor during the audit should use the override code below.

door code, yagap-bahof: bdg-O-05

The Driftbox parcel-tracking webhook failed to redeploy this morning because its credentials vault entered a locked state after repeated token refresh failures. New team members: do not restart the webhook service, as that will requeue thousands of duplicate delivery notifications to carrier partners. First confirm the vault status in the operations console, then notify the on-call lead before proceeding. When the lead approves the unseal, open the vault using the recovery passphrase noted below.

unlock words, fajef-yahip: belys-holius-istmir-holius-holok-aldok-jordor